Chief Executive Officer, Climate KIC

Dr. Kirsten Dunlop is Chief Executive Officer at Climate KIC, Europe’s foremost climate innovation agency and community. Climate KIC leads NetZeroCities, enabling implementation of the European Union’s Mission on Climate Neutral and Smart Cities. She brings to her role a deep conviction in our capacity to learn and evolve into a climate-resilient society, and her over 30 years of experience catalyzing systemic transformations in a career spanning academia, consulting, banking, and the insurance industry, across three continents. Kirsten serves on various Advisory Boards and is recognized as a leader at the European Commission Economic and Societal Impact of Research and Innovation (ESIR) expert group. A specialist in experiential learning and cross-disciplinary practice, she holds a Ph.D. in Cultural History from the University of East Anglia and a BA Hons in Art History from the University of Sydney.
